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Histologically or cytologically confirmed diagnosis of squamous cell lung cancer 2. Unresectable stage III-IV or postoperative recurrence patients unfitted for definitive hemoradiotherapy 3. Chemotherapy is planned regardless of pre-treatment history 4. Signed informed consent

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: None

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
To clarify the clinicopathological and molecular feature in squamous cell lung cancer harboring FGFR gene alterations

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
To evaluate the frequencies and characteristics of any cancer-related gene alterations in squamous cell lung cancer using OCP(Cancer Panel)
